avatarSinkingDuel2 years ago

Absolutely! Custom MTG token cards are a big hit in the community. As long as your tokens are clearly marked as not official Wizards of the Coast (WotC) products to avoid confusion, you should be good to go. Players love unique tokens for their decks, and if your designs are cool or quirky, you might find quite a market for them.
